The Importance of Google Reviews
Google reviews not only affect the public perception of your business, but they also directly influence your company’s local ranking on Google Maps. Proper management of reviews can increase potential customers' trust and improve your business's position in local search results.
Challenges of Managing Reviews Manually
Managing Google reviews manually can be a slow and error-prone process. Companies with multiple locations face the challenge of maintaining consistency and speed in responses, which is crucial for maintaining a good online reputation. Additionally, the lack of a centralized strategy can lead to inconsistencies in NAP (Name, Address, Phone) information, negatively affecting local rankings.

Best Practices for Managing Google Reviews
1. Respond Quickly: Ensure you respond to reviews within 24 to 48 hours. This shows that you value your customers' opinions.
2. Be Professional: Maintain a professional and courteous tone in all your responses, even in the face of negative feedback.
3. Always Thank: Thank customers for their feedback, regardless of whether it is positive or negative.
4. Learn from Criticism: Use constructive criticism to improve your services and products.
